Company Profile

Thermo Fisher Scientific Oy is a Finland-based manufacturer of    laboratory instruments and in vitro diagnostic (IVD) devices, headquartered in    Vantaa, Finland. Operating as a subsidiary of    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. (NYSE: TMO),    the company maintains dual manufacturing and R&D sites in    Vantaa and Joensuu, serving research, clinical diagnostic, and industrial markets across Europe and globally.

Market Position & Certifications

Thermo Fisher Scientific Oy holds a strategic Nordic hub position within the global scientific instrumentation market,    competing with Danaher,    Agilent, and    PerkinElmer. Key strengths include:

Dual-site operations: Vantaa (R&D, diagnostics, and instruments) and Joensuu (consumables and liquid handling)
   • Regulatory compliance: ISO 9001:2015, ISO 13485:2016 (MDSAP), EN ISO 13485:2016, and ISO 14001:2015 certified
   • Group synergy: Integrated into Thermo Fisher Scientific's global supply chain and e-commerce network
   • 600+ colleagues at the Vantaa site as part of the Nordic operations team

Corporate Timeline

2006 — Established within the Thermo Fisher Scientific group structure following the Thermo Electron and Fisher Scientific merger
   2009 — Parent company acquired Finnzymes Oy (Espoo, Finland), expanding molecular biology and PCR reagent capabilities
   2021 — TCAutomation system registered in China (国械备20210503号) for clinical sample processing
   2024 — Continued as a core Nordic manufacturing and diagnostics hub with upgraded automation lines
   2026 — Maintains full ISO-certified production across Vantaa and Joensuu facilities serving European and global markets
